Red Bull Music Academy NY returns - 2015 lineup & schedule (return of the Storm Rave, GHE20G0TH1K, a Kid Millions commission & much more)

The Red Bull Music Academy will once again take over NYC this year from May 1-30 with several very cool events and various venues. This year includes a night of all African electronic artists at Villain, a GHE20G0TH1K’s biggest ever party which will happen at BK Bazaar with a big lineup including New Orleans Bounce ‘sissy rapper’ Sissy Nobby‘s first-ever NYC appearance, the premiere of a new Kid Millions (of Oneida) piece with 20 musicians, a conversation with A$AP Rocky, a PC Music showcase with all their artists and SOPHIE at BRIC House, a conversation with George Clinton, the biggest-ever Nothing Changes party at Output with Merzbow and many others, a Tri Angle Records 5th anniversary party on Wall Street with most of the label’s roster, the return of Frankie Bones’ Storm Rave party, the debut of FKA twigs’ new live show with dancers and more, an Arthur Russell tribute with Dev Hynes, Cults, Phosphorescent (UPDATE: Phosphoresent was initially listed as part of this but is no longer on the lineup), Sam Amidon, Little Scr…
